The Black Business Circle presented its 2004 ECONOMIC EMPOWERMENT EXPLOSION SUMMIT EXPO June 12, 2004 Thomas Jefferson High School, Brooklyn, New York
The Economic Empowerment Explosion Summit & Expo featured vendors such as entrepreneurs, community organizations and businesses and provided networking opportunities. The conference showcased training opportunities, workshops, press reception room, refreshment, entertainment, awards and networking. Black Business Circle received proclamations from four levels of government including Congress, Brooklyn Borough Presidents Office, NYC City Council and the State Senator office.
